On Friday 31st August, the Belorussian National Final for the Junior Eurovision Song Contest took place. Daniel Yastremsky will represent his nation on home ground with the song, “Time”, beating 9 other participants. The stage for this year’s Junior Eurovision Song Contest, to be held in Minsk has been revealed. This year’s stage has been designed by Galina Gomonova. The main stage is 14 metres-circular, with a smaller stage 7 metres-circular. Both stages are connected by a 7 metre bridge. The […]
